The Role of Digital Imaging in Planning Full-Mouth Implants for Patients with Temporomandibular Joint Disorders in Australia

Digital imaging has become a cornerstone of modern dental treatment planning, particularly for complex procedures like full-mouth implants. For patients with temporomandibular joint disorders (TMJ), this technology plays a critical role in ensuring precise, safe, and effective outcomes. This article explains how digital imaging supports the planning of full-mouth implants for individuals with TMJ, the benefits of this approach, and considerations for patients in Australia.


Overview of Digital Imaging in TMJ Implant Planning

Digital imaging, including cone beam computed tomography (CBCT), 3D imaging, and intraoral scanners, has revolutionised the way dental professionals assess and plan implant procedures. For patients with TMJ disorders, which involve issues with the jaw joint and surrounding muscles, traditional 2D X-rays often fall short. Digital imaging provides a detailed, three-dimensional view of the jawbone, nerves, and TMJ anatomy, enabling dentists to customise implant placement to avoid complications.

Australian health guidance from the Australian Institute of Health and Welfare (AIHW) highlights that digital imaging is essential for complex restorative cases, as it allows for accurate bone volume assessment and identification of anatomical landmarks. For TMJ patients, this precision is crucial, as the joint’s proximity to critical structures like the maxillary sinus and mandibular nerve can complicate implant placement.


Who Is This Treatment For?

Full-mouth implants are typically recommended for patients with multiple missing teeth, severe periodontal disease, or significant bone loss. However, individuals with TMJ disorders may require additional consideration due to the complexity of their condition.

Patients with TMJ disorders often experience symptoms such as jaw pain, limited mouth opening, and temporomandibular joint dysfunction. These issues can affect the stability of the jaw and the surrounding bone, making traditional implant planning challenging. Digital imaging helps mitigate these risks by providing a comprehensive view of the patient’s oral anatomy, allowing dentists to tailor treatment plans to individual needs.

The Better Health Channel (Victorian Government) notes that patients with TMJ disorders may benefit from digital imaging to ensure implants are placed in areas that do not compromise joint function or cause discomfort. This approach is particularly valuable for patients with a history of trauma, arthritis, or chronic jaw pain.


How the Treatment Works: The Role of Digital Imaging

Planning full-mouth implants for TMJ patients involves a multi-step process that leverages digital imaging to ensure precision and safety. Here’s how it works:

1. Initial Diagnostic Imaging

The first step is to obtain high-resolution 3D images of the patient’s jaw using a cone beam CT (CBCT) scan. Unlike traditional X-rays, CBCT provides a detailed, three-dimensional view of the bone, nerves, and TMJ. This allows dentists to:

  • Assess bone density and volume to determine implant feasibility.
  • Identify anatomical landmarks such as the maxillary sinus, mandibular nerve, and TMJ capsule.
  • Evaluate the patient’s occlusion (bite) to ensure implants align with functional and aesthetic goals.

2. Customised Treatment Planning

Once the imaging data is collected, dental professionals use specialised software to create a virtual model of the patient’s mouth. This model enables them to:

  • Simulate implant placement and test different configurations.
  • Adjust the number and position of implants to accommodate TMJ-related constraints.
  • Plan surgical procedures to avoid nerve damage or joint irritation.

The University of Melbourne – Melbourne Dental School explains that digital imaging allows for a more accurate assessment of bone quality and quantity, which is critical for patients with TMJ disorders who may have compromised bone structure due to chronic inflammation or degeneration.

3. Surgical and Restorative Stages

With a detailed plan in place, the treatment progresses to the surgical phase. Digital imaging guides the placement of implants, ensuring they are positioned to avoid critical structures. For patients with TMJ issues, this step is particularly important to prevent complications such as nerve damage or joint instability.

After the implants are placed, restorative procedures like crowns or bridges are fabricated using data from the digital scans. This ensures a precise fit and long-term functionality.


Recovery and Post-Treatment Considerations

Recovery from full-mouth implant surgery varies depending on the patient’s overall health and the complexity of the procedure. For TMJ patients, recovery may involve additional considerations to manage joint-related discomfort.

1. Immediate Post-Operative Care

Patients are typically advised to rest for the first 24–48 hours after surgery. Pain management is achieved through prescribed medications, and a soft diet is recommended to avoid strain on the jaw.

2. Monitoring TMJ Symptoms

Patients with TMJ disorders should monitor their symptoms during recovery. If they experience increased pain, swelling, or difficulty opening their mouth, they should contact their dentist immediately.

3. Long-Term Maintenance

Successful outcomes depend on regular check-ups and proper oral hygiene. Patients are encouraged to:

  • Brush and floss around implants daily.
  • Avoid habits like bruxism (teeth grinding), which can compromise implant stability.
  • Use a night guard if they have a history of TMJ-related bruxism.

The Australian Government – Department of Health emphasises that adherence to these guidelines can help prolong the lifespan of implants and reduce the risk of complications.

Risks and Suitability for TMJ Patients

While digital imaging significantly improves the safety and success of full-mouth implants, certain risks and factors must be considered.

1. Potential Complications

  • Nerve Damage: Although rare, there is a risk of injury to the inferior alveolar nerve during implant placement. Digital imaging minimises this risk by mapping nerve pathways.
  • Joint Irritation: Implants placed too close to the TMJ capsule may cause discomfort or affect joint function. Precise planning using 3D imaging helps avoid this.
  • Infection: As with any surgical procedure, there is a small risk of infection. Patients must follow post-operative care instructions to mitigate this.

2. Suitability Criteria

Patients with TMJ disorders may be suitable candidates if:

  • Their joint condition is stable and not actively inflamed.
  • They have sufficient bone density to support implants.
  • They are committed to long-term oral hygiene and follow-up care.

The International Team for Implantology (ITI) notes that a multidisciplinary approach—combining dental expertise with input from physiotherapists or TMJ specialists—can optimise outcomes for complex cases.
